作为一名热衷于用苹果签名进行内测的创业者,我深知内测流程的繁琐与复杂。今天,就让我来分享一段关于苹果企业签名申请的真实经历,带你们一起感受内测路上的得与失。
一、内测流程
内测流程是苹果企业签名申请的第一步,也是至关重要的一步。首先,我们需要注册一个苹果开发者账号,这是进行内测的基础。注册账号后,我们需要填写一些基本信息,包括公司名称、联系方式等。接下来,我们需要上传公司营业执照等证件,以证明我们的企业身份。
在完成账号注册后,我们就可以申请企业签名了。申请企业签名需要提交App的IPA文件,并选择合适的签名类型。目前,苹果提供了TF签名和超级签名两种类型。TF签名适用于小规模内测,而超级签名则适用于大规模内测。
二、设备管理
在进行内测时,设备管理是必不可少的环节。我们需要确保所有参与内测的设备都能正常使用。为此,我们可以使用苹果的Xcode进行设备管理。Xcode是一款功能强大的开发工具,可以帮助我们轻松管理设备。
在Xcode中,我们可以添加设备,查看设备信息,以及为设备安装App。此外,Xcode还支持远程调试,方便我们在内测过程中发现问题并及时解决。
三、TF签名与超级签名的使用感受
在申请苹果企业签名时,我们选择了TF签名和超级签名两种类型。下面,我将分别谈谈这两种签名的使用感受。
1. TF签名
TF签名适用于小规模内测,操作简单,易于上手。在使用TF签名时,我们只需将App的IPA文件上传到苹果的iTunes Connect平台,然后生成TF签名即可。TF签名的优点是速度快,但缺点是签名有效期较短,一般为7天。
2. 超级签名
超级签名适用于大规模内测,可以满足更多设备的需求。在使用超级签名时,我们需要将App的IPA文件上传到第三方平台,然后生成超级签名。超级签名的优点是有效期长,但缺点是操作相对复杂,需要一定的技术支持。
四、P12证书管理
在申请苹果企业签名时,我们需要生成P12证书。P12证书是苹果企业签名的核心,用于加密App的IPA文件。在管理P12证书时,我们需要注意以下几点:
1. 保管好P12证书,避免泄露;
2. 定期备份P12证书,以防丢失;
3. 更换P12证书时,确保所有设备都能正常使用。
五、证书防掉签技巧
在进行内测时,证书掉签是一个常见问题。为了防止证书掉签,我们可以采取以下措施:
1. 使用官方渠道申请企业签名,确保证书的安全性;
2. 定期检查证书有效期,提前申请续签;
3. 在设备上安装证书,确保设备与证书绑定。
六、遇到的小问题
在内测过程中,我们也遇到了一些小问题。以下是一些常见问题的解决方案:
1. 设备无法连接到Xcode:检查设备是否已开启开发者模式,以及是否已信任Xcode证书;
2. App无法安装:检查App的IPA文件是否损坏,以及是否已正确生成签名;
3. 证书掉签:按照上述方法检查证书有效期,并提前申请续签。
七、苹果开发者账号、H5封装、AppStore上架、IPA签名
1. 苹果开发者账号:注册苹果开发者账号是进行内测的基础,确保我们的企业身份。
2. H5封装:为了方便用户在手机上使用我们的App,我们采用了H5封装技术。在封装过程中,我们需要注意兼容性、性能等问题。
3. AppStore上架:在完成内测后,我们将App提交到AppStore进行上架。在提交过程中,我们需要注意App的描述、截图、评分等。
4. IPA签名:在AppStore上架前,我们需要对IPA文件进行签名,确保App的安全性。
总结
通过这次苹果企业签名申请的经历,我深刻体会到了内测路上的得与失。虽然过程中遇到了一些问题,但通过不断摸索和解决,我们最终成功完成了内测。在这个过程中,我学会了如何管理设备、使用TF签名和超级签名、管理P12证书以及防止证书掉签。这些经验对我今后的创业之路具有重要意义。